What Are the Key Features of a High-Quality Infant Bathtub?
The key features of a high-quality infant bathtub include:
- Safety Features: A high-quality infant bathtub should have non-slip surfaces and a secure design to prevent accidents during bath time. These features often include built-in safety harnesses or contoured shapes that keep the baby securely in place.
- Comfort: The tub should be ergonomically designed to provide comfort for both the baby and the caregiver. This includes a soft, padded surface or a gentle incline that supports the baby’s head and back, making bath time enjoyable for everyone.
- Versatility: Many top-rated infant bathtubs are designed for multiple uses, such as transitioning from a newborn tub to a toddler bath. This adaptability can save space and money, allowing for a longer period of use as the child grows.
- Ease of Cleaning: A quality infant bathtub should be made from materials that are easy to wipe down and disinfect. Look for designs that do not have hard-to-reach corners or crevices where dirt and grime can accumulate.
- Portability: The best-rated infant bathtubs often feature lightweight designs or collapsible structures, making it easy to transport or store when not in use. This is particularly useful for families with limited space or those who travel frequently.
- Temperature Indicators: Some high-quality infant bathtubs come equipped with temperature indicators that alert caregivers if the water is too hot or too cold. This feature helps ensure that bathwater is at a safe and comfortable temperature for the baby.
- Durability: A good infant bathtub should be made from high-quality, durable materials that can withstand regular use without cracking or breaking. This longevity is essential for ensuring safety and performance over time.
- Drainage System: An effective drainage system is crucial for easy water removal after each bath. Look for bathtubs with plug systems or angled designs that allow water to flow out quickly and efficiently.
What Safety Considerations Should You Keep in Mind When Choosing an Infant Bathtub?
When choosing the best-rated infant bathtub, several safety considerations must be taken into account.
- Stability: Ensure the bathtub has a wide and sturdy base to prevent tipping during use. A stable design helps keep the baby secure and minimizes the risk of accidents while bathing.
- Non-slip Features: Look for bathtubs with non-slip surfaces or rubber grips to prevent slipping. These features provide additional safety by ensuring that both the baby and the caregiver can maintain a secure grip during bath time.
- Material Safety: Choose bathtubs made from BPA-free and non-toxic materials. Safety from harmful chemicals is crucial since infants are more sensitive to toxins, and safe materials can prevent skin irritation or other health issues.
- Size Appropriateness: Select a bathtub that fits the infant’s size and age. An appropriately sized bathtub ensures the baby is supported correctly, minimizing the risk of slipping under the water or struggling to stay comfortable.
- Drainage System: A good bathtub should have an effective drainage system to allow for easy water removal. Proper drainage helps to maintain hygiene and prevents water from pooling, which can lead to bacteria growth.
- Safety Harness: Some bathtubs come with a safety harness or straps to keep the baby secure. These harnesses are designed to prevent the infant from slipping or sliding around, thus reducing the risk of accidents during bath time.
- Ease of Use: Consider bathtubs that are easy to fill, empty, and clean. Convenience in usage ensures that bath time remains a safe and enjoyable experience for both the caregiver and the baby.
